Alcenia's

$ | Pinch District

The food at this hole-in-the-wall lunch spot just north of downtown is as down-home and funky as the decor—walls lined with eclectic artwork and a jukebox stocked with Memphis hits. The kitchen turns out its own versions of "meat and two," including fried chicken and pork chops served alongside sweet-potato fries, fried green tomatoes, and other vegetables. Desserts, including pecan pie and sweet potato pie, bread pudding, and pound cake, are as sinfully rich as the sweet tea Alcenia's serves up in tall glasses.

Alfred's on Beale

$

Not surprisingly, music is the theme at this busy restaurant on Beale Street, the city's bluesy entertainment district. Up to 500 people can be accommodated inside and on the two-story outdoor patio. Southern plate lunches, burgers, pork chops, pasta, catfish, and barbecued ribs make up the comforting menu. The kitchen is open until 3 am; on weekends the bar serves until 5 am. Bands play Thursday through Sunday, and there's karaoke Monday through Wednesday.

Charlie Vergos' Rendezvous

$$

They sell plenty of dry-style barbecued ribs in this downtown restaurant in an 1890 building, in an alley just north of the Peabody Hotel. A diverse group chows down in the antiques- and collectibles-filled basement dining room, and the service is among the most efficient in town. The menu also includes shoulder sandwiches, pork loin, chicken, and a shrimp skillet.

Westy's

$ | Pinch District

This unpretentious bar and grill, which sits in the shadow of the Pyramid alongside the Mississippi River, dishes out large portions of steak and seafood, excellent burgers, and a full selection of rice-based dishes, including several vegetarian options. A weekday "Meat and two" lunch special includes features entrees like country-fried steak and catfish, accompanied by sides like macaroni and cheese, turnip greens, and other vegetables. The kitchen stays open until 3 am, seven nights a week.
